La Crosse’s mayor and council members meet with school superintendent to discuss a vision for the city’s school district

They called it a “visioning” meeting.
A gathering of La Crosse government leaders, including the mayor, a few city council members, and the La Crosse superintendent of schools, took place on Monday at the school district headquarters.
Superintendent Aaron Engel had a list of questions for the panel, such as identifying what the public schools do well, and what they hope the school district will be known for in 10 years.
Mayor Shaundel Washington Spivey said in order to thrive, students need to be confident and know themselves. The mayor also praised the idea of year-round school, which the district does offer. Engel noted that students can take classes throughout the calendar year, if they choose a schedule where class is available 240 days a year. City council president Tamra Dickinson said she likes that the school district Facebook page promotes positive things that schools and students are doing.

Engel says this meeting is part of a broader plan for listening sessions with groups from throughout the community, “kind of a shared goal to create a shared vision for the future, not just one that the school district holds or the city holds, but working together and continuing to collaborate to make the La Crosse community be the best it can be.” Engel says the public assumes the schools are going to teach reading, writing and arithmetic, but he argues the city group wants children “to be good citizens, to be good people, to work hard,” and “find satisfaction in life.”
The elected officials spoke about their concerns for families struggling with housing costs, and making sure that kids in the La Crosse schools are not left behind, compared with students in other communities.
